Long Description: Strain of other muscle(s) and tendon(s) at lower leg level, left leg, subsequent encounter. Version 2019 of the ICD-10-CM diagnosis code S86.812D. Valid for Submission. The code S86.812D is valid for submission for HIPAA-covered transactions.

What is the ICD 10 code for strain of other muscles?

Strain of other muscle(s) and tendon(s) at lower leg level, unspecified leg, initial encounter. S86.819A is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2018/2019 edition of ICD-10-CM S86.819A became effective on October 1, 2018.

What is the ICD 10 code for left thigh muscle strain?

Left thigh muscle strain ICD-10-CM S76.912A is grouped within Diagnostic Related Group (s) (MS-DRG v38.0): 537 Sprains, strains, and dislocations of hip, pelvis and thigh with cc/mcc 538 Sprains, strains, and dislocations of hip, pelvis and thigh without cc/mcc

What is a gluteal tear?

A gluteus medius tear is a condition characterized by severe strain on the gluteus medius muscle that results in partial or complete rupture of the muscle. The gluteus medius is one of the major muscles of the hip and is essential for movement of the lower body and keeping the pelvis level during ambulation.

What's the difference between a strain and a sprain?

The difference between a sprain and a strain is that a sprain injures the bands of tissue that connect two bones together, while a strain involves an injury to a muscle or to the band of tissue that attaches a muscle to a bone.
